Ho Chi Minh city need 10,000 billion dongs for flood prevention

Laws- 4th session of Steering Committee Meeting of project on flood prevention for Ho Chi Minh City which was chaired by Mr. Dao Xuan Hoc, Deputy Minister of Agriculture and Rural Development   took place on 18 November 2009 in Ho Chi Minh City.

T his session was to evaluate situation on implementation of work under decision No. 1547/QD-TTg on 28 October 008 of the Prime Minister; review contents proposed to implement in the 3rd session of Steering Committee meeting on 18 August 2009; and propose solutions to accelerate progress of project implementation to ensure that the 1st stage can be completed in 2012.

Speaking at the session, representatives from project investors affirmed that capital is a decisive factor to speed up project progress, therefore, Ministry of Agriculture and Rural Development and relevant agencies need to balance and allocate additional fund to project to implement it as scheduled.

Regarding this matter, Mr. Dao Xuan Hoc, Deputy Minister of Agriculture and Rural Development said, apart from state budget fund, functional agencies and project investors can propose and establish other funding mechanism to speed up project progress.

It was expected that investment capital in 1st stage of the project was more than 10.000 billion dongs for construction of 12 tide prevention culvert including Muong Chuoi, Thu Bo, Kinh Lo, tide control culvert Nhieu Loc- Thi Nghe, Kinh river tide prevention culvert…

Sai Gon river dyke system and 9 main axes of drainage in Ho Chi Minh City and Long An, in which Management Unit of Irrigation investment and construction No.9 (Unit No. 9), Ministry of Agriculture and Rural Development is the project investor of 03 large culverts./.
